金矿石中高含量锑的断续流动氢化物发生-原子荧光光谱法快速测定

摘    要:采用王水(1+1)水浴分解样品,氢化物发生-原子荧光光谱法(HG-AFS)测定金矿石中高含量的锑.其方法回收率在95.0%-102.0%之间,相对标准偏差在1.0%-3.4%之间,方法检出限为3.0×10-10g/mL,经试验证实该方法可测范围宽、简便、快速、准确,实验室间对比分析结果吻合程度令人满意.

Rapid Determination of High Content Sb in Gold Ore with Interrupted Flow by Hydride Generation-Atomic Fluorescence Spectrometry

Abstract:With aqua regia-water bath to decompose the sample,a method for the determination of high content Sb in gold ore by hydride generation-atomic fluorescence spectrometry(HG-AFS)is reported.The method recovery is 95.0%~102.0%,the relative standard deviation is 1.0%~3.4%,detection limit is 3.0×10-10 g/mL.Experiments rerified that the method has the adventages of wide measurement range,simplicity.rapidity and higher accuracy.The results of contrast analysis among laboratories are satifactory.
